Kelsey Mitchell’s historic 2026 continued on Friday with the Indiana Fever star setting a new WNBA single-season record for points scored. Mitchell’s three-pointer in the third quarter against the Toronto Tempo gave her 1,023 points for the season, surpassing the previous mark of 1,021 set by A’ja Wilson in 2024.
